The complainant requested a trade effluent consent register and trade effluent sampling results. Northern Ireland Water (NIW) disclosed some information and relied on regulation 12(5)(e) of the EIR to withhold the sampling data. Regulation 12(5)(e) concerns the confidentiality of commercial or industrial information. NIW has advised the Commissioner that it’s also now relying on regulation 12(5)(b) to withhold the sampling data. This exception concerns the course of justice. The Commissioner’s decision is as follows: NIW can’t rely on regulation 12(5)(e) to withhold the sampling data as this information is on emissions for the purposes of regulation 12(9) of the EIR. Regulation 12(9) prevents such information from being withheld under regulation 12(5)(e). The sampling data also doesn’t engage regulation 12(5)(b) of the EIR. The Commissioner requires NIW to take the following steps to ensure compliance with the legislation: Disclose the information to which it has applied regulation 12(5)(e) and 12(5)(b) of the EIR.
